Output 12bf811034608b2dff005d8d250f8b5c3eed0dd237a9a8d703a9cc0119082075:6

value
42266678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ab12bbeaf69ec0a5a61e0593b4cba0419da5199 OP_EQUAL
address
MDFVfc2mjuvUUQ1PcRgYQftqfBBoUEYzAM
transaction
12bf811034608b2dff005d8d250f8b5c3eed0dd237a9a8d703a9cc0119082075
spent
true